Smith is a niggler who grapples and slows players in the tackle, but that is just doing his job. He is coached to do that stuff, he does it well, and most players would wish they could do it and get away with it as well as he does.

But he would be a damn fine player without all that rot too, and the NRL could have stopped a lot of the nonsense in tackles and the ruck years ago if they wanted, and we wouldn't be talking about it. I think he is the most influential player in the game, in terms of contributing to his team's success, at club and state level.

The reason I can't stand him and think it would be an embarassment for the game if he becomes QLD and Australian captain is because of the 2 contracts, salary cap nonsense that he was an integral part of, and remains completely unrepentant for, even though it has meant every premiership for 5 years has been a pointless, tarnished venture.

But I don't think the knees in the back was all that bad (a bit clumsy, but on the origin scale a pretty minor act) and I do think he was sorry about it.
